Our routine appointment time is 5 to 10 minutes. If you have a number of issues which you wish to discuss with your Doctor, please inform the receptionist when booking your appointment.
The receptionist is not being nosey!
All reception staff at Greyfriars Surgery has had training to enable us to ask certain questions to ensure you receive:
- the most appropriate medical care
- from the most appropriate Health Professional
- at the most appropriate time
Receptionist are required to collect brief information from patients:
- this helps Doctors prioritise house visits and phone calls
- to ensure that all patients receive the appropriate level of care
- to direct patients to see the Nurse or other Health Professional rather than a Doctor where appropriate
Reception staff, like all members of the team, are bound by confidentiality rules
- any information given is treated as strictly confidential
- the Practice would take any breach of confidentiality very seriously and deal with accordingly
- you can ask to speak to a receptionist in a private area away from reception
- if you feel an issue is very private and do not wish to say the reason then this will be respected.

Please only attend the GP Practice if you have been asked to.
Patients must attend their appointment alone, unless they have specific needs.
Do not arrive any more than 5 minutes early before your appointment time.
Patients are advised to attend the practice wearing a face covering.
The number of seats available in the waiting area are limited. Patients should only sit on disunited chairs. Patients may be asked to wait in alternative areas.
